ULTRASONIC SONAR RADAR ROBOT

PIC18F2420 microcontroller board radar robot project for detection msu05 ultrasonic sensor module this module is used instead of the alternative ultra sonic by adding other modules or op amp amplifier circuits, 40 kHz ultrasonic sensor can be used. SAA1027 motor driver IC stepper motor driver is being used on the floor of the computer connection is USB interface FT232 used

Sonar Radar Robot project program (java xp32bit-64 bit and linux) has been granted, together with the C software source codes, pic18f2420 schema and pcb files.

Scanning Sonar robot Scan sonar is a robotic tool for visualization of the environment of a mobile robot. A sonar sensor motor, allows to have an ultrasound image on the screen of a computer. This scanning is carried out over 180 °. A good knowledge of electronic circuit design is an asset for the realization of sonar. C programming concepts and Java can adapt to the needs of this implementation designer.
